FORM F UNIFORM MOTOR CARRIER BODILY INJURY AND PROPERTY DAMAGE LIABILITY INSURANCE ENDORSEMENT
| It is agreed that: | |||
| 1. The certification of the policy, as proof of financial responsibility under the provisions of any State motor carrier law or regulations promulgated by any State Commission having jurisdiction with respect thereto, amends the policy to provide insurance for automobile bodily injury and property damage liability in accordance with the provisions of such law or regulations to the extent of the coverage and limits of liability required thereby; provided only that the insured agrees to reimburse the company for any payment made by the company which it would not have been obligated to make under the terms of this policy except by reason of the obligation assumed in making such certification. | |||
| 2. The uniform motor carrier bodily injury and property damage liability certificate of insurance has been filed with the State Commissions indicated on the reverse side hereof. | |||
| 3. This endorsement may not be cancelled without cancellation of the policy to which it is attached. Such cancellation may be effected by the company or the insured giving thirty (30) days' notice in writing to the State Commission with which such certificate has been filed, such thirty (30) days' notice to commence to run from the date the notice is actually received in the office of such department. | |||

FORM G UNIFORM MOTOR CARRIER BODILY INJURY AND PROPERTY DAMAGE LIABILITY SURETY BOND (Executed in triplicate)
| Know all men by these presents, that we, (Name of Motor Carrier Principal) ____________ of ____________ (City) ____________, (State) as principal (hereinafter called principal), and ____________, (Name of Surety) a corporation created and existing under the laws of the State of ____________, with principal office at ____________ (City) ____________, (State) as Surety (hereinafter called surety), are held and firmly bound unto the State of ____________ in the sum or sums hereinafter provided for which payment, well and truly to be made, the principal and surety hereby bind themselves, their successors and assigns, firmly by these presents. | ||
| The condition of this obligation is such that: | ||
| Whereas, the principal is or intends to become a motor carrier subject to the laws of such State and the rules and regulations of __________ (Name of Department) (hereinafter called Department), relating to insurance or other security for the protection of the public, and has elected to file with the Department a surety bond conditioned as hereinafter set forth; and | ||
| Whereas, this bond is written to assure compliance by the principal a motor carrier of passengers or property with the laws of such State and the rules and regulations of the Department relating to insurance or other security for the protection of the public, and shall inure to the benefit of any person or persons who shall recover a final judgment or judgments against the principal for any of the damages herein described. | ||
| Now, therefore, if every final judgment recovered against the principal for bodily injury to or the death of any person or loss of or damage to the property of others, sustained while this bond is in effect, and resulting from the negligent operation, maintenance or use of motor vehicles in transportation (but excluding injury to or death of the principal's employees while engaged in the course of their employment, and loss of or damage to property of the principal and property transported by the principal designated as cargo), shall be paid, then this obligation shall be void, otherwise to remain in full force and effect. | ||
| Within the limits hereinafter provided, the liability of the surety extends to such losses, damages, injuries, or deaths regardless of whether such motor vehicles are specifically described herein and whether occurring on the route or in the territory authorized to be served by the Principal or elsewhere. | ||
| This bond is effective from _______________(12:01 a.m., standard time , at the address of the principal as stated herein) and shall continue in force until terminated as hereinafter provided. The principal or the surety may at any time terminate this bond by written notice to the Department, such termination to become effective not less than thirty (30) days after actual receipt of said notice by the Department. The surety shall not be liable hereunder for the payment of any judgment or judgments against the principal for bodily injury to or the death of any person or persons or loss of or damage to property resulting from accidents which occur after the termination of this bond as herein provided, but such termination shall not affect the liability of the surety hereunder for the payment of any such judgment or judgments resulting from accidents which occur during the time the bond is in effect. | ||
| The liability of the surety on each motor vehicle shall be the limits prescribed in the laws of such State and the rules and regulations of the Department governing the filing of surety bonds, which were in effect at the time this bond was executed, and will be a continuing one notwithstanding any recovery hereunder.
